Please stay away from this company. I strongly regret my experience with them. I traded with this company for about one year and spent thousands of dollars purchasing their challenges, believing that one day I would successfully qualify and receive a payout. That day finally came, but unfortunately, my $16,000 payout was denied. I was extremely disappointed and frustrated after investing so much time and money into their program. Looking back, I regret ignoring the red flags and the warnings from other traders. I believe my experience is something potential customers should be aware of before spending their money. Based on my experience, I would strongly advise new traders to do extensive research, read their hidden rules carefully, and look at independent reviews before purchasing any challenge or mentorship from this company.

This review shines a light on the practices employed by Funding Dynasty (a prop firm owned by George Statie, who also owns Trading Busters) and how their terms & conditions for funded accounts make it so difficult to receive a payout, particularly if using a single strategy, it may as well be defined as impossible. For context, I have purchased a $200,000 Instant Funded account from Funding Dynasty. In my review below, I'll use that $200,000 account as an example, trading with Busters Signals or Busters Bot – George's very own signals and EA (Expert Advisor), two products assured to work without friction via Funding Dynasty. Note: don't take my word for it, examine the T&Cs yourself. Do your own research. Read the other 1-star reviews so you can get a better/more faithful picture of Funding Dynasty. I'll cover the pertinent rules first: 1) There is a maximum daily drawdown/maximum overall drawdown that must be adhered to. This is pretty standard across the prop firm industry. The maximum daily drawdown on an Instant Funded account is 3%, and the maximum overall drawdown is 6%. 2) There's a responsible trading policy, which on that same account means that you can't risk more than 1.5% of the initial balance in a single trade, or across multiple trades. 3) There's a minimum single-day net profit rule of 0.75%, which, on a $200k account means you have to make $1,500 in one day of trading before you qualify for a payout. 4) There's also a 20% consistency rule, which states that to qualify for a payout, your best trading day must not account for more than 20% of your total profits at the time of withdrawal. If you break this rule, you have to trade out the inconsistency. A safe and consistent trading risk is 1%. You're staying within the max drawdown limits (1), and complying with the responsible trading policy (2). Trading with Busters Signals or Busters Bot is only once per day, and with the two-order strategy they use (recovery/hedging), a winning first order trade on a $200,000 funded account will make approximately $100 profit. A winning second-order trade will potentially make more... but then you fall foul of the 20% consistency rule. If you actually want a payout (and you will, otherwise why pay money to a prop firm?), you can't stay consistently making $100 per day. There's the 0.75% rule (3). To achieve a single day's profit of $1500 you would have to raise the risk from a nice and safe 1% to dangerous levels. This would break the responsible trading policy. If you *were* able to achieve the $1500, say, by trading multiple strategies with different instruments/staring at the charts all day – frequently advised by George as the way *not* to do it, hence the heavy marketing of Busters Signals/Busters Bot - you've then also got to contend with the 20% consistency rule. Using Busters Signals/Busters Bot, if a trader drops back to a safe 1% risk after achieving that $1500, it would then take 60 additional flawless winning days just to balance the account's consistency score. Tracking the trades as I have over the last 8 months, that many wins in a row is... unlikely. Oh, and losing days with the Busters Signals/Busters Bot strategies are typically large. The second order is 9x the first order, so a losing day with a 1% risk on a $200,000 account is actually $2000 in total. Which will then take 20 trading days to recover at the same 1% risk. But that's a review for another day. Even if all of this *were* navigable, which it absolutely isn't using a single strategy such a Busters Signals, or Busters Bot, there's an extra clause (3.1.11), which states that: 'Opening positions with sizes that are noticeably larger than those of the Customer’s other trades, whether on this account or another one of theirs, is prohibited.' In summary, the combination of rules adds up to an operational paradox, to ensure you never achieve a payout.
